サポート
MySQLで文字化けする場合の対策
MySQLのバージョンが4.1以降で、MySQLの文字コードの設定がUTF-8でない場合に
日本語が文字化けすることがあります。
文字化けした場合には以下の設定をお試しください。
MySQLのデータベースをUTF-8に設定する
MySQLのデータベースの文字コードを管理ツールphpMyAdminなどからUTF-8(utf8_general_ci等)に設定します。
すでにグループウェアのテーブルが作成されている場合は削除し、再度セットアップを行ってください。
データベースの文字コードの変更ができない場合にはテーブルの文字コードをUTF-8にします。
すでに挿入されているデータは文字化けしていますので、データを追加・編集しください。
グループウェアの設定ファイルを変更する
MySQLのデータベースやテーブルの文字コードをUTF-8にしても文字化けが改善しない場合は、
グループウェアの設定ファイルを変更します。
設定ファイルは「group/application/config.php」です。
以下の行を変更します。
//データベース文字コード
define('DB_CHARSET', false);
↓
//データベース文字コード
define('DB_CHARSET', true);
編集した設定ファイルをサーバーにアップロードしてください。
初期のファイルを編集してアップロードした場合は再度セットアップを行ってください。
セットアップ後の設定ファイルを変更した場合にはセットアップは必要ありません。
すでに挿入されているデータは文字化けしていますので、データを追加・編集しください。
設定ファイルはUTF-8で書かれていますので、秀丸エディタやTerapadなど、UTF-8が編集できる
エディタで編集してください。
(Windowsのメモ帳で編集すると動作に不具合が出ることがあります。)
*グループウェアの設定ファイル変更による文字化け対策を行う場合、 PHP5.2.3以降、MySQL 5.0.7以降でmysql_set_charset関数が使用できる 環境で利用してください。

グループウェア
CMS
顧客管理システム
FLV Player